Excelence on production: the performance of professional soccer players

The present article analyzes the factors that influence the performance of soccer players and the contextual factors related to their performance. In this study the following people were interviewed: 2 former-athletes, 2 players that are still active, 2 coaches and 2 physical trainers, all experienced and renowned. The article aims at verifying which are the factors considered important for the performance of soccer players. Content analysis was performed on the data of the interviews. Results show that many factors are related to the context that influences the performance. These can be divided in categories involving psychological, physical, technical and tactical factors; there were also factors that involve the social background offered to the player. From the categories raised, the basis for the development of a questionnaire involving the main subjects of the interviews was elaborated and will be used in a following study.
